What are the qualifications about?

The Level 3 Award in Dental Nursing focuses on essential practical skills and knowledge for all aspects of dental nursing.

The skills will complement your existing understanding of dental equipment, instruments and materials in your role within an oral healthcare team.

Who are they for?

The Level 3 Award in Dental Nursing is for people who already work within an oral healthcare team and who want to learn how to prepare and maintain dental environments, instruments and equipment for clinical dental procedures.

You may also want to build on your existing NVQ and VRQ Dental Nursing qualifications and move into a different progression route such as:

- specialist dental nursing roles
- dental hygiene or therapy
- dental technology
- teaching dental nursing.

  • What sorts of things do they cover?

    The Level 3 Award in Dental Nursing covers areas like:

    • providing effective chairside support during the assessment of a patient's oral health
    • producing dental images
    • providing support during the prevention and control of periodontal disease and restoration of cavities.
  • How will I learn and be assessed?

    To get a Vocationally Related Qualification (VRQ) you learn with your training provider  - maybe through practical sessions, group discussions or assignments.

    For the Level 3 Award in Dental Nursing you'll be assessed via a written examination.
